Design Features and Variations
The Desert Eagle Case Hardened is renowned for its striking design, which features a combination of metallic tones and vibrant colors. The skin's appearance changes based on its wear level, ranging from Factory New to Battle-Scarred. Each wear level offers a unique visual experience, catering to different player preferences.
Key Design Elements
- Factory New: A pristine condition with minimal wear, showcasing the skin's full potential with bright colors and a glossy finish.
- Minimal Wear: Slightly worn edges, with a more subdued color palette while retaining the skin's overall appeal.
- Field-Tested: More pronounced wear marks, giving the skin a rugged, battle-tested look.
- Well-Worn: Significant wear, with a more muted color scheme and visible scratches.
- Battle-Scarred: The most worn condition, featuring heavy scratches and discoloration, adding character to the skin.
